We live out in the country with a well that is quite far from the house (approx. 200 feet) The well ran dry the other day so I had it filled by a local water supply company. I have a single line jet pump and an air bladder cold water tank. The pressure pump will now pump it up to pressure (about 45 psi) and shut off. But as soon as it does, there is a swooshing sound at the pump and the water seems to drain back out to the intake line until the pressure is so low the pump cycles back on (at about 20psi). This takes about 15 seconds each time the pump shuts off. I suspect that when the water ran out in the well, the pumped sucked in some air at the foot valve. There seems to be an air lock in the line and won't allow proper operation of the pump. How do I correct this problem? .... Frank
